Transaction e953646105d252ed758f72d8a680c27fedeb6f3a19109955dc84d0a81747658d
1 Input
1 Output
-
e953646105d252ed758f72d8a680c27fedeb6f3a19109955dc84d0a81747658d:0
- value
- 139035
- script pubkey
- OP_0 OP_PUSHBYTES_20 f46dcc27717af62dfe864500e3ef92bafe5f22fb
- address
- bc1q73kucfm30tmzml5xg5qw8mujhtl97ghm888edn